*** Pendiente de traducción *** Claude Code is an agentic coding tool. From 2.1.38 until 2.1.163, Claude Code's worktree handling allowed creation of worktrees named ".git" and navigation to worktrees outside the sandbox context, enabling git directory confusion attacks. By exploiting symlink manipulation and git fsmonitor execution during worktree operations, an attacker could overwrite files in the user's home directory (such as .zshenv), leading to code execution outside of seatbelt sandbox restrictions. Reliably exploiting this required the user to clone a malicious repository containing prompt injection content and run Claude Code against it.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.1.163.
